Geo Location Information for 211.75.194.243 IP Address. The IP Address 211.75.194.243 is located at 25.0478 latitude and 121.532 longitude in Taiwan. Friendly Location for the IP Address is Taipei, Taipei, Taiwan (province Of China), 10048
全新打造的部落格系統,提供多人同時使用,並給訪客優質好文,歡迎多多造訪。